Biography of Gypsy Rose and Dee Dee Blanchard

Gypsy Rose Blanchard was born on July 27, 1991, in Baton Rouge, Louisiana. From a young age, she displayed various health issues, which her mother, Dee Dee Blanchard, claimed were numerous and severe. Dee Dee, born on September 1, 1967, was known for her overprotective nature and her tendency to seek attention through her daughter’s supposed illnesses.

The Toxic Relationship between Gypsy and Dee Dee

The relationship between Gypsy and Dee Dee was marked by manipulation and control. Dee Dee exhibited behaviors consistent with Munchausen syndrome by proxy, fabricating illnesses for Gypsy to gain sympathy and attention. Gypsy was subjected to unnecessary medical treatments and procedures, leading to a life of dependency and isolation.

Signs of Manipulation

  • Frequent hospital visits for non-existent ailments
  • Isolation from peers and family
  • Control over Gypsy's personal choices and freedoms

This toxic environment left Gypsy feeling trapped and desperate for autonomy, ultimately leading to the tragic events that unfolded.

The Crime Scene: What Happened?

On June 14, 2015, the body of Dee Dee Blanchard was discovered in their home. She had been stabbed multiple times. Gypsy Rose was found in a neighboring house, safe but visibly shaken. The investigation revealed that Gypsy, with the assistance of her boyfriend, had orchestrated this tragic act as a means of escaping her mother's control.

Aftermath and Legal Consequences

The aftermath of the crime was complex. Gypsy Rose was charged with second-degree murder and ultimately pleaded guilty to a lesser charge of involuntary manslaughter. She was sentenced to ten years in prison, with the possibility of parole.
